In case you are having your SAT exam the very next day, here is what all you need to do.

Pack all your stuff: You don’t have to waste your time on finding a pencil or eraser in the examination hall. Stuff all the essentials in the bag-pack a night before. Make sure you have kept your SAT-approved ID card and its copy (in case of emergency). All your SAT preparation can go in vain if you don’t take care of these essentials.



Wear a wristwatch: Efficient time management is essential for scoring the best marks in an exam. It’s a good idea to go through the entire question paper first and start answering the easier questions first. Keep a check on time and make sure that you have ample of time for the difficult questions to be solved. Revise and stay at home: One should relax a night before the SAT exam. It is not a good idea to study hard or chill out with friends on the night before. Revise all your important notes but do not stress out. Wake up fresh early morning and head to the examination hall.

Stay away from unhealthy food: Yes! Food can considerably affect your performance of the SAT exam. Unhealthy and greasy sugary food can make you feel all dizzy and drowsy and you don’t want to sleep in your exam for sure. You can treat yourself with ice-creams and pizzas once the exam is done but before that you should seriously avoid that. 

Do some breathing exercises: It is natural to feel anxious and nervous right before the exam for some students. In such case you can do some breathing exercises or meditation to quell all your anxiety and attempt your exam with confidence.
